_January 14_ to _17_.--When sitting on the poop Mr. Elphinstone
kindly entertained me with information about India, the politics
of which he has had such opportunities of making himself
acquainted with. The Afghans, to whom he went as ambassador, to
negotiate a treaty of alliance in case of invasion by the
French, possess a tract of country considerably larger than
Great Britain, using the Persian and Pushtu languages. Their
chief tribe is the Doorani, from which the king is elected. Shah
Zeman was dethroned by his half-brother Mahmood, governor of
Herat, who put out his eyes. Shah Zeman's younger brother
Shoujjah took up arms, and after several defeats established
himself for a time. He was on the throne when Mr. Elphinstone
visited him, but since that Mahmood has begun to dispute the
sovereignty with him. Mr. Elphinstone has been with Holkar and
Sindia a good deal. Holkar he described as a little spitfire,
his general, Meer Khan, possessed abilities; Sindia none; the
Rajah of Berar the most politic of the native powers, though the
Nizam the most powerful; the influence of residents at Nagpoor
and Hyderabad very small.
_February 17._--Mostly employed in writing the Arabic tract,
also in reading the Koran; a book of geography in Arabic, and
_Jami Abbari_ in Persian.
I would that all should adore, but especially that I myself
should lie prostrate. As for self, contemptible self, I feel
myself saying, let it be forgotten for ever; henceforth let
Christ live, let Christ reign, let Him be glorified for ever.
_February 18._--Came to anchor at Bombay. This day I finish the
30th year of my unprofitable life, an age in which Brainerd had
finished his course. He gained about a hundred savages to the
Gospel; I can scarcely number the twentieth part. If I cannot
act, and rejoice, and love with the ardour some did, oh, let me
at least be holy, and sober, and wise. I am now at the age at
which the Saviour of men began His ministry, and at which John
the Baptist called a nation to repentance. Let me now think for
myself and act with energy. Hitherto I have made my youth and
insignificance an excuse for sloth and imbecility: now let me
have a character, and act boldly for God.
_February 19._--Went on shore. Waited on the Governor, and was
kindly accommodated with a room at the Government House.
